Effect of UMMB (urea molasses multi-nutrient block) based on coffee skin on erythrocytes, hematocrit and hemoglobin in transport stress of sheep Sri Ruwandani; Yunilas; Ade Trisna

Abstract

Transportation stress in livestock can be caused by distance and travel time, crowding in the transport vehicle, malnutrition during transportation, climatic conditions, lack of availability of food and drink and lack of handling during travel. The aim of providing coffee peel-based UMMB is to overcome nutritional deficiencies and stress in livestock during transportation. This research was carried out experimentally with a non-factorial completely randomized design (CRD) with 4 treatments K0 (without UMMB) as control, K1 (UMMB based on 10% fermented coffee peel), K2 (UMMB based on 20% coffee peel), K3 (UMMB based on fermented coffee peel 30%) and 4 repetitions. The research parameters are erythrocytes, hematocrit and hemoglobin. The results showed that administration of UMMB based on fermented coffee peel had a significant effect (P<0.05) on reducing erythrocyte levels (16.58%), decreasing hematocrit levels (18.30%) and decreasing hemoglobin levels (31.72%). The conclusion of this research is that administering coffee peel-based UMMB at a dose of 30% can reduce erythrocyte, hematocrit and hemoglobin levels in sheep transportation stress
Anthelmintic Activity Test of Young Areca Nut (Arecha catechu L.) Extract Against Fasciola sp. Worm Eggs in Goat Feces In Vivo Siregar, Alzahra wulandari; Nurzainah Ginting; Ade Trisna

Abstract

Worm infections in livestock can have a huge risk impact such as decrease in growth, body weight, meat quality and death. This study aims to determine the anthelmintic activity of young areca nut extract (Areca catechu L.) against Fasciola sp. worm eggs in goat feces in vivo and to determine at what concentration the young areca nut extract (Areca catechu L.) is effective in providing anthelmintic effects against worm eggs. The study used an experimental method with a paired t-test of 5 treatments and 4 replications. The treatments given were P0 (negative control), P1 (10% areca nut extract), P2 (20% areca nut extract), P3 (30% areca nut extract) and P4 (positive control using kalbazen worm medicine). Parameters were reduction in the number of dead worm eggs, lethal concentration,  effectiveness of areca nut extract against worm eggs. The results of the study showed that there were Fasciola sp. worm eggs in all tested goats. Treatment with young areca nut extract (Arecha catechu L.) can significantly reduce the number of Fasciola sp. eggs (P <0.05), with an LC50 result of 26.75%. The best Fecal Egg Count Reduction Test (FECRT) result in the administration of areca nut extract with a concentration of 30% (P3) of 56.75% was the same as that given treatment using kalbazen worm medicine and the lowest FECRT result in the administration of areca nut extract with a concentration of 20% (P2) of 29%.
The Effect of Adding Batak Onion Juice (Allium chinense G. Don) on the Physical and Organoleptic Quality of Chicken Nuggets Sarina br Nainggolan; Ade Trisna; G A W Siregar

Abstract

Chicken nuggets are processed products that are easily contaminated if the processing and storage of the product are not good. Batak onions contain antioxidant compounds that can prevent oxidative damage to chicken nuggets. This study aims to determine the effect of using Batak onion juice on the physical quality and organoleptic quality of chicken nuggets. The study was conducted at the Technology Research Laboratory, Faculty of Agriculture and the Animal Production Laboratory, Faculty of Agriculture, University of North Sumatra in November 2023. The research design used was RAL (Completely Randomized Design) with 4 treatments, namely P0 = 0%, P1 = 5%, P2 = 10%, P3 = 15% and 5 replications. The parameters of this study were physical quality tests, namely pH, cooking loss, water holding capacity, and organoleptic tests of color, taste, aroma and texture. The results of this study indicate that Batak onion juice with a concentration of 5%, 10%, 15% has a significant effect (P <0.05) on the physical quality and organoleptic quality of taste and aroma in chicken nuggets but does not affect the color and texture
The Effect of Salak (Salacca zalacca) Leaf Silage in Complete Feed on Digestibility and Characteristics in Vitro Fermantation Nasution, Riska Romaito; Trisna, Ade; Ginting, Simon P

Abstract

The purpose of this study is to establish the best proportion of salakleaf silage utilisation in complete feed based on dry matter digestibility, organic matter digestibility, pH value, VFA generation, and NH3 concentration. The method used in this study was experimental with a 4 x 4 Randomized Block Design (RBD), using four distinct treatment ratios and 4 times rumen fluid collection as a repeat group. The percentage of salakleaf treatments in complete feed were: P0 (15% elephant grass in complete feed), P1 (15% salakleaf in complete feed), P2 (30% salakleaves in complete feed) and P3 (45% salak leaves in complete feed). The observed variables consisted of dry matter digestibility, organic matter digestibility, pH value, VFA production, and NH3 concentration. The mathematical model used is an analysis of variance and if there are differences between treatments it is continued with the DMRT (Duncan's Multiple Range Test) test (Steel and Torrie, 1991). The results revealed that the treatment ration had no significant (P>0.05) influence on pH value and had a very significant effect (P<0.01) on dry matter digestibility, organic matter digestibility, VFA production, and NH3 concentration. This study concluded that using 30% silage of salakleaves in complete feed could maintain the pH value and increase the dry matter digestibility, organic matter digestibility, pH value, VFA production, and NH3 concentration.

Abstract

Penelitian ini bertujuan untuk mengetahui pengaruh bentuk dedak padi terhadap kualitas fisiknya yakni kerapatan tumpukan, kerapatan pemadatan tumpukan dan berat jenis. Penelitian ini menggunakan dedak padi dengan dua bentuk yaitu dedak padi kasar dan halus yang diambil di kilang padi usaha baru, Juli Keude Dua, Bireuen. Metode penelitian yang digunakan adalah metode eksperimen dengan Rancangan Acak Lengkap (RAL), Perlakuan A: Dedak Padi Kasar (ada campuran sekam) dan Perlakuan B: Dedak Padi Halus (Tanpa campuran sekam). Setiap perlakuan diulang sebanyak 10 kali. Peubah yang diamati adalah kerapatan tumpukan (g/ml), kerapatan pemadatan tumpukan (g/ml) dan  berat jenis (g/ml). Hasil dari penelitian ini menunjukan bahwa perlakuan tidak memberikan pengaruh nyata (P0,05) terhadap kerapatan tumpukan, kerapatan pemadatan tumpukan dan berat jenis. Kesimpulan dari penelitian ini adalah kualitas fisik dedak padi kasar ataupun dedak padi halus secara statistika memiliki kualitas fisik yang sama namun secara angka perlakuan B (dedak halus) memiliki kualitas fisik yang lebih tinggi dibandingkan dengan perlakuan A (dedak kasar). Dedak padi halus (perlakuan A) memiliki nilai kerapatan tumpukan 0,34 g/ml, kerapatan pemadatan tumpukan 0,50 g/ml dan berat jenis 1,70 g/ml.

Abstract

Penelitian ini bertujuan untuk mengetahui kajian performa produksi ayam broiler pada sistem kandang closed house di peternakan UD. Bilkis. Peternakan UD. Bilkis memiliki daya tampung ayam broiler sebanyak 12.000 ekor, Peternakan UD. Bilkis terletak di Kabupaten Bireun. Performa yang dianalisis adalah bobot badan (g), konsumsi ransum (g) dan konversi ransum ayam broiler UD. Bilkis. Pengambilan data pada penelitian ini berlangsung dari tanggal 01 Oktober 2023 – 04 November 2023. Data diambil dalam satu periode panen. Metode penelitian yang digunakan adalah studi kasus. Pengumpulan data dilakukan dengan metode observasi, wawancara, dokumentasi dan dianalisis dengan metode deskriptif kuantitatif. Hasil dari penelitian didapatkan rataan bobot badan yaitu 1.874 g/ekor atau 1,90 kg/ekor, konsumsi ransum 3.144,77 g/ekor/minggu atau 3,14 kg/ekor/minggu dan nilai FCR 1,68. Serta data penunjang deplesi 1,82%. Kesimpulan dari penelitian ini adalah peternakan UD. Bilkis menenjukkan performa produksi yang baik dana sudah sesuai dengan standar dari produksi ayam broiler.

Abstract

"Activist Farm" is a sheep and goat farm that was established aimed at increasing the income of farmers and has the concept of integrating livestock whose target is to meet the protein needs of the community and the fulfillment of livestock seeds as a center for goat and sheep production in North Sumatra province. The limited knowledge and skills in raising livestock such us to procurement of feed ingredients, ration formulation and maintenance management encouraged coaching team from University of sumatera utara to provide assistance / coaches. Several technologies from research results of the university can be applied, so that they can motivated farmers to increase their business, increase farmer income and in order to support protein resilience during a pandemic. As a solution in overcoming this problem, it is necessary to increase knowledge and skills in the cultivation of goats, the introduction of alternative sources of feed ingredients (feed ingredients based on agricultural by-products, plantations, food processing industries) and livestock waste processing to support the productivity of goats to reduce production costs, making complete silage feed, making probiotics and formulating goat and sheep rations. The specific target of this activity is that farmers are able to determine potential alternative feed to be given for goats, are able to make probiotics for fermentation, complete fermentation and formulate rations, understand good farm management and efforts to improve biosecurity in supporting livestock health and the environment. The service method is packaged in the form of lectures, discussions, demonstrations, training and pilot projects. Service activities are summarized in a guidebook in the form of a Goat and Sheep Maintenance Management Module. From this activity, it is targeted that there will be cost efficiency (savings in animal feed costs because it can utilize alternative sources of feed ingredients), formulating and making independent concentrate feed, savings in the cost of purchasing probiotics and organic fertilizer fermentation methods.

The Effect of Fenugreek Paste on Physical Quality and Organoleptic Quality Meatballs Made From Chicken Meat Nur Laila; Peni Patriani; Ade Trisna

Abstract

Meatballs is a processed meat product and one of Indonesia's favourite culinary delights. This study aims to determine the effect of fenugreek paste on the physical and organoleptic quality of meatballs made from chicken meat. The research was conducted in June-July 2023 at the Research and Technology Laboratory, Faculty of Agriculture, and Animal Production Laboratory, Faculty of Agriculture, University of No Sumatra. The design used in this study was RAL (Completely Randomised Design) with 4 treatments, namely P0 = 0%, P1 = 5%, P2 = 10%, P315%, and 5 replications. The parameters    in this study were physical quality tests, namely meatball pH and cooking loss, and organoleptic tests of color, aroma, taste, and tenderness. The results showed that 5%, 10%, 15% fenugreek paste had a very significant effect (P<0.01) on physical quality and organoleptic quality. The higher the percentage of fenugreek paste used in meatballs, the higher the physical and organoleptic quality of meatballs In conclusion of this study is that fenugreek is good to add to get quality meatballs
